B. Simone is an American actress, comedian, beautician, rapper, singer, and internet personality. She is best known for being one of the recurring cast members since Season 9, but later returned to the show in Season 11 until Season 16, and her return to the show again in Season 18 of the improv comedy show, Wild 'N Out, on MTV and VH1.

In August 2018, she began headlining her comedy tour "You're My Boooyfriend" Comedy Tour which features internet comedian and actor Desi Banks and her fellow cast member Darren Brand.
On March 10, 2019, she began starring in the original series, You're My Boooyfriend on the Zeus Network, along with her Wild 'N Out fellow cast member Vena E.. On March 28, 2019, she had a miniseries on the Wild 'N Out YouTube channel called "F*** Boi Court".
In August 2021, she hosts the podcast series MTV's "Women of Wild 'N Out" that airs on iHeartRadio, along with her fellow cast members Vena E. and Justina Valentine.
In March 2022, she hosts the podcast series "The Know For Sure Pod" that airs on Apple Podcasts, along with Megan Brooks.
Trivia[]
- She has appeared in 3 episodes in Seasons 9 and 19, 5 episodes in Season 11, 16 episodes in Season 12, every episode in Season 13, 17 episodes in Season 14, 14 episodes in Season 15, 15 episodes in Season 16, 8 episodes in Season 18, 13 episodes in Season 20, and 1 episode so far in Season 21.
- She was entirely on the New School team in Season 15.
- Her comedy special premiered along with her fellow cast members Cortez Macklin, Big Mack, Tyler Chronicles, Clayton English, and Mope Williams on the Wild 'N Out YouTube channel in May 2019 on Wild 'N Out Presents.
- She is the second longest running female cast member.
- She originally auditioned to be a Wild 'N Out girl but later became a cast member instead.
- She was also casted as late R&B singer Aaliyah in biopic about her life.
- She is known for her catchphrase "Baby Girrrll!", that is said in a high tone voice.
- Her father is a pastor.
